Output f18c93730649af87fc32a6193bf632d4d58489e0f38f0193535a110843b4ea90:0

value
138206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90dfa29129aa52cd9ebf3719e509bee658cd697c OP_EQUAL
address
3Eu38bqYGGJWTfYS2RfGvXR58beToDu9FV
transaction
f18c93730649af87fc32a6193bf632d4d58489e0f38f0193535a110843b4ea90
spent
true